    Applying Ubuntu Updates on SEL

    When I ssh in to my HomeTroller it tells me that there are X number of updates available. Is it ok to apply them? Ubuntu tends to be a little more particular sometimes with it's system updates not playing nicely with programs running in "production".

    On a Windows box, I'd have no problem installing the updates because they tend not to break things and it's very easy to uninstall an update if it does break something. With Unix, that's not always true.

    I have not experienced any issues with my system by applying the OS updates. However, it appears some of the updates may replace the "HomeSeer" boot entry with "Ubuntu". It would be nice to get an official answer from HomeSeer though.
